In the world of climbing every gram matters and reliability can be a safety issue. This is amplified when darkness falls. To keep operating with a good margin of safety you need innovative, dependable, and sustainable lighting solutions.

Our range of headtorches is designed with an understanding of the unique challenges climbers face. Headlamps, developed with input from experienced climbers, strike a perfect balance between brightness, beam pattern, and battery life. Climbing often requires both close-up illumination for route-finding and gear management, as well as long-distance lighting for spotting anchors or assessing the terrain ahead. For this reason, our headlamps feature multiple lighting modes, enabling you to easily switch between flood and spot beams.

A standout feature is the red light mode, which preserves night vision—a critical need for early alpine starts or multi-day big wall climbs. The intuitive controls are designed to be easily operated with gloved hands.
